The Fresh Egg Cookbook

From Chicken to Kitchen, Recipes for Using Eggs from Farmers' Markets, Local Farms, and Your Own Backyard

by Jennifer Trainer Thompson

Readily available at farmers’ markets, local farms, and gourmet shops, and from the ever-more-present backyard chicken coop, fresh eggs offer nutritional benefits as well as delicious flavor. With The Fresh Egg Cookbook, author and chicken keeper Jennifer Trainer Thompson serves up 101 creative recipes for enjoying and celebrating the versatility of eggs.

From the perfect soft-boiled egg to French toast, omelets, eggs Florentine, and huevos rancheros, readers will find a wealth of favorite breakfast offerings with new twists. Local, fresh eggs bring out the best in classic preparations such as Caesar salad, spaghetti carbonara, eggnog, and homemade mayonnaise. In recipes ranging from smoothies to casseroles, deviled and stuffed eggs to stews, Thompson offers inventive variations for spicing up eggs and combining them with fresh seasonal vegetables for every meal of the day. She also shares amusing anecdotes about her own chickens and family life with a backyard flock.

With easy recipes and tasty flavor combinations, The Fresh Egg Cookbook is the perfect book for any egg-loving kitchen (and especially one within clucking distance of a backyard coop!).

About the Author: Jennifer Trainer Thompson is the author of 11 cookbooks, including The Fresh Egg Cookbook. She has been featured in Martha Stewart Living and has written for Yankee, Travel & Leisure, The Boston Globe, The New York Times, and other publications. Thompson is the chef/creator of Jump Up and Kiss Me, an all-natural line of spicy foods. She lives in western Massachusetts with her family and a flock of backyard chickens.
